### This Week's Must-See Concerts in Philadelphia
**Tuesday, April 22** kicks off with **VANA's Lady in Red Tour at The Fillmore Philadelphia**. Doors open at 8pm with tickets priced at $35, promising an evening of sultry, atmospheric performances. Also performing tonight is rising artist **Calum Scott** at the same iconic venue—perfect for last-minute ticket hunters looking for intimate yet epic acoustics.
For free music lovers, don't miss **Virga performing at Ortlieb's** as part of the beloved **Weeknights Live series** starting at 6pm (courtesy of Philadelphia Magazine and JamBase listings).
**Wednesday, April 23** brings the soul-shaking energy of **St. Paul & The Broken Bones to The Fillmore**, presented by WXPN. Expect powerful horns, emotional vocals, and unforgettable stage presence for just $40. This Birmingham-based soul powerhouse delivers one of the most dynamic live shows in contemporary music.
**Thursday, April 24** features **SlimeGetEm at Concourse Dance Bar** (6pm, free admission) as part of Weeknights Live, perfect for hip-hop heads seeking authentic Philly vibes.
### Weekend Festival Highlights
**Friday, April 24** launches **Making Time Festival at Franklin Music Hall** with an incredible electronic lineup including **fcukers, Avalon Emerson, and Tiga**. Doors at 8pm, $50 advance tickets—prepare to dance until dawn with some of the finest names in house, techno, and electronic music.
**Saturday, April 25** showcases **Inner Wave & Los Mesoneros at The Foundry** ($30 tickets) for lovers of dreamy indie rock and Latin alternative sounds—a perfect blend of atmospheric guitar work and infectious rhythms.

### Weekly Live Music Rituals & Free Concerts
Never miss **Weeknights Live**, Philadelphia's premier free weekly concert series:
- **Mondays**: East Passyunk neighborhood venues like **Pistolas del Sur** (6pm, free)
- **Wednesdays**: Baltimore Avenue corridor shows
- **Wednesday, May 6**: Open mic night in West Philly (Metro Philly listing)
These neighborhood showcases offer the authentic "Philly glow-up" experience—grassroots music in intimate settings where tomorrow's headliners play today.
